Girls Inc. of Manchester, NH is seeking an After-School Program Group Leader to create and run engaging activities for girls aged 5-13.
You will supervise a cohort of up to 15 participants, provide homework help, and lead arts, crafts, STEM projects with a focus on safety and nurturing support. The role emphasizes enthusiasm, responsibility, and serving as a positive role model within our mission to inspire girls to be strong, smart, and bold.
